Dusk in Utsunomiya, stage by stage
Dusk in Utsunomiya runs the same three stages as dawn, in reverse. Once the sun sets, civil dusk, the last usable light, lingers until the sun is 6 degrees below the horizon. Nautical dusk follows at 12 degrees, when the sea horizon disappears, and astronomical dusk at 18 degrees, after which the sky is fully dark and the faintest stars appear. How long dusk lasts depends on Utsunomiya's latitude: near the equator night falls fast, while at high latitudes dusk can stretch for hours or, in high summer, never fully darken.
